Two days of Review Stakes at the Illinois State Fair came to a conclusion with Express Glide capturing the $70,000 Review-Greyhound in 1:59.3 for his second victory in as many starts. Earlier, Jeansandatshirt won the $38,000 Review for freshman filly trotters in 1:57.3. Express Glide, with Brent Holland in the bike, sat fourth at the rail as Magic Carpet Ride and Andy Miller got away with pedestrian fractions of :29.4, 1:02.1 and 1:32.1. But by the head of the stretch Express Glide had come first-over to challenge the leader, and with a final panel in :27.2 swept into the lead for the victory over Southwind Tagar and Brandon Simpson with The Vatican and Dewayne Minor third. A $125,000 yearling purchase from the Brittany Farms consignment at the Lexington Select Yearling Sale, the son of Yankee Glide has won both of his starts for trainer Ervin Miller and owners Jack and Peggy Hood, Ken Duffy and Mystical Marker Farms. In the Review Stakes freshman filly trot, Andy Miller moved Jeansandatshirt to the lead after an opening half in 1:00.4 and with a last quarter in :28 breezed to her second straight victory in five starts. Spiceberry Hanover and Mike Oosting were second with Greathearted and Brooke Nickells third. Bred by Kentuckiana Farms Gen Par and Mar-Lo Stables, the daughter of Self Possessed was a $40,000 yearling purchase and is also trained by Ervin Miller for Mystical Marker Farms, Shim Racing and the Ervin Miller Stable. In other Review Stakes action Tuesday evening, Don’t Deny Me (Allamerican Ingot) captured the $30,000 three-year-old filly pace in 1:51.1 for Michael Oosting and Vette man (Artiscape) won the $37,000 Review-Baker 3-year-old colt and gelding pace in 1:50.1 for Brandon Simpson.
